Historical Context: The 1905 Kangra Earthquake
The 1905 Kangra earthquake, which struck the region with a magnitude estimated between 7.8 and 8.0, remains one of the most catastrophic seismic events in Indian history. It resulted in widespread destruction, claiming thousands of lives and causing extensive damage to buildings and landscapes. Experts highlight that this historical event serves as a stark reminder of the Himalayan region's vulnerability to major earthquakes, underscoring the urgency for modern planning strategies.
Current Challenges and Recommendations
Seismologists and urban planners point to several key challenges in the Himalayas, including rapid urbanization, inadequate building codes, and limited disaster response capabilities. To address these issues, they propose a multi-faceted approach:
- Enhanced Building Standards: Implementing and enforcing stricter seismic-resistant construction codes to ensure structures can withstand potential earthquakes.
- Infrastructure Resilience: Upgrading critical infrastructure such as roads, bridges, and communication networks to maintain functionality during and after seismic events.
- Community Preparedness: Launching public awareness campaigns and training programs to educate residents on earthquake safety and emergency response protocols.
- Early Warning Systems: Investing in advanced seismic monitoring and early warning technologies to provide timely alerts and reduce casualties.
These recommendations aim to create a more resilient Himalayan ecosystem, capable of withstanding future seismic shocks while minimizing human and economic losses.
